36 schools will benefit from the government supports.
The Department of Education is offering further supports to 36 disadvantaged schools in the midlands.
Five urban primary schools in Laois, three in Westmeath and one in Offaly will see a one point reduction in the student-teacher ratio to 23:1.
Two secondary schools in Laois and three each in Westmeath and Offaly will also see a five per cent increase in funding for the School Completion Programme, to support the attendance and participation of vulnerable students.
